ホームページ  >  記事  >  PHPフレームワーク  >  Laravelでテンプレートのサフィックスを変更する方法

Laravelでテンプレートのサフィックスを変更する方法

PHPz
PHPzオリジナル
2023-03-31 17:16:28627ブラウズ

Laravel は人気のある PHP Web アプリケーション フレームワークであり、MVC パターンに基づいており、開発者が高品質の Web アプリケーションを迅速に開発するのに役立つ多くの便利な機能とツールを提供します。 Laravel アプリケーションの開発では、開発者は多くの場合、フレームワークのデフォルトのテンプレートのサフィックスを変更する必要があります。では、Laravel でテンプレートのサフィックスを変更するにはどうすればよいでしょうか?順を追って紹介していきましょう。

ステップ 1: config/view.php ファイルを変更する

Laravel アプリケーションのルート ディレクトリで config ディレクトリを見つけ、このディレクトリで view.php ファイルを見つけます。このファイルは、Laravel アプリケーションのビュー エンジン構成項目を定義します。このファイルの「extensions」配列内の「blade.php」文字列を、「html」や「tpl」などの必要なテンプレート サフィックスに変更する必要があります。例は次のとおりです。

'extensions' => [
    'html',
],

ステップ 2: ビュー ファイルのファイル サフィックスを変更する

Laravel アプリケーションのビュー ファイル ディレクトリ (通常は resource/views ディレクトリの下) で、次のものが必要です。すべてのビューを追加するには ファイルのサフィックスが、最初のステップで設定したテンプレートのサフィックスに変更されます。そうしないと、Laravel はビュー ファイルを正しくロードできなくなります。例は次のとおりです。

welcome.html

ステップ 3 (オプション): コントローラーのビュー戻り関数を変更する

Laravel アプリケーションのコントローラーでは、ビュー戻り関数を使用して渡すことがよくあります。 data 次のようなビュー ファイルを指定します。

return view('welcome');

これを次のように変更する必要があります。

return view('welcome.html');

Summary

上記の 3 つの手順を通じて、テンプレート サフィックスを正常に変更できます。 Laravelアプリケーションの。テンプレートのサフィックスを変更した後は、すべてのビュー ファイルのサフィックスも変更されていることを確認する必要があることに注意してください。そうしないと、ビュー ファイルが正しくロードされません。

以上がLaravelでテンプレートのサフィックスを変更する方法の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。